* Grazvydas Ignotas <notasas@xxxxxxxxx> [081112 01:48]:
> Remove the unused devconf_loopback_clock field from twl_mmc_controller.
> control_devconf_offset only changes for DEVCONF1, so move it out.

> Signed-off-by: Grazvydas Ignotas <notasas@xxxxxxxxx>
> ---
>  arch/arm/mach-omap2/mmc-twl4030.c |   19 +++++++------------
>  1 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 12 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/mmc-twl4030.c b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/mmc-twl4030.c
> index 32625e7..b1fe0f3 100644
> ---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/mmc-twl4030.c
> +++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/mmc-twl4030.c
> @@ -50,26 +50,21 @@
>  #define VMMC_DEV_GRP_P1		0x20
>  
>  static u16 control_pbias_offset;
> +static u16 control_devconf1_offset;
>  
>  #define HSMMC_NAME_LEN	9
>  
>  static struct twl_mmc_controller {
>  	struct omap_mmc_platform_data	*mmc;
> -	u32		devconf_loopback_clock;
> -	u16		control_devconf_offset;
>  	u8		twl_vmmc_dev_grp;
>  	u8		twl_mmc_dedicated;
>  	char		name[HSMMC_NAME_LEN];
>  } hsmmc[] = {
>  	{
> -		.control_devconf_offset		= OMAP2_CONTROL_DEVCONF0,
> -		.devconf_loopback_clock		= OMAP2_MMCSDIO1ADPCLKISEL,
>  		.twl_vmmc_dev_grp		= VMMC1_DEV_GRP,
>  		.twl_mmc_dedicated		= VMMC1_DEDICATED,
>  	},
>  	{
> -		/* control_devconf_offset set dynamically */
> -		.devconf_loopback_clock		= OMAP2_MMCSDIO2ADPCLKISEL,
>  		.twl_vmmc_dev_grp		= VMMC2_DEV_GRP,
>  		.twl_mmc_dedicated		= VMMC2_DEDICATED,
>  	},
> @@ -257,9 +252,9 @@ static int twl_mmc1_set_power(struct device *dev, int slot, int power_on,
>  
>  		/* REVISIT: Loop back clock not needed for 2430? */
>  		if (!cpu_is_omap2430()) {
> -			reg = omap_ctrl_readl(c->control_devconf_offset);
> +			reg = omap_ctrl_readl(OMAP2_CONTROL_DEVCONF0);
>  			reg |= OMAP2_MMCSDIO1ADPCLKISEL;
> -			omap_ctrl_writel(reg, c->control_devconf_offset);
> +			omap_ctrl_writel(reg, OMAP2_CONTROL_DEVCONF0);
>  		}
>  
>  		reg = omap_ctrl_readl(control_pbias_offset);
> @@ -305,9 +300,9 @@ static int twl_mmc2_set_power(struct device *dev, int slot, int power_on, int vd
>  	if (power_on) {
>  		u32 reg;
>  
> -		reg = omap_ctrl_readl(c->control_devconf_offset);
> +		reg = omap_ctrl_readl(control_devconf1_offset);
>  		reg |= OMAP2_MMCSDIO2ADPCLKISEL;
> -		omap_ctrl_writel(reg, c->control_devconf_offset);
> +		omap_ctrl_writel(reg, control_devconf1_offset);
>  		ret = twl_mmc_set_voltage(c, vdd);
>  	} else {
>  		ret = twl_mmc_set_voltage(c, 0);
> @@ -325,11 +320,11 @@ void __init hsmmc_init(struct twl4030_hsmmc_info *controllers)
>  
>  	if (cpu_is_omap2430()) {
>  		control_pbias_offset = OMAP243X_CONTROL_PBIAS_LITE;
> -		hsmmc[1].control_devconf_offset = OMAP243X_CONTROL_DEVCONF1;
> +		control_devconf1_offset = OMAP243X_CONTROL_DEVCONF1;
>  		nr_hsmmc = 2;
>  	} else {
>  		control_pbias_offset = OMAP343X_CONTROL_PBIAS_LITE;
> -		hsmmc[1].control_devconf_offset = OMAP343X_CONTROL_DEVCONF1;
> +		control_devconf1_offset = OMAP343X_CONTROL_DEVCONF1;
>  	}
>  
>  	for (c = controllers; c->mmc; c++) {
